Abstract

PURPOSE:To facilitate the easy mounting of a window type air conditioner without extruding itself outward by a method wherein stepped parts provided on both sides of the air conditioner are insertedly fitted to installation frames equipped with a sliding frame and a panel, which cover the space left above the sliding frame, and the installation frames and both side surfaces of the air conditioner are coupled by hole-hook engagement means and finally a top surface part and an upper frame are fixed to each other by means of a screw. CONSTITUTION:An opening for mounting an air conditioner 1 is formed between right and left vertical frames 8 and between the lower and upper frames 10 and 9 by sliding the upper frame 9 on the installation frames 3, the upper and lower ends of which are fixed to window frames 2 and the space left above the upper frame 9 is closed by the panel 13. After that, the air conditioner 1 is insertedly fitted in the opening for mounting the air conditioner 1 by engaging the holding holes 17 provided on the side surfaces of the air conditioner 1 with the hooks 23 of the installation frames 3. Then, a top surface flange 19 and the upper frame 9 are fixed to each other by means of a through hole 21, a screw seat 30 and the screw 22. Owing to the structure as mentioned above, the mounting and dismounting of the air conditioner 1 can be easily and surely performed.

DETAILED DESCRIPTION OF THE INVENTION The present invention relates to an improvement in a mounting device for mounting a window-mounted air conditioner, which does not protrude outward, to an installation frame, and particularly relates to an improvement in the mounting device for mounting or removing the air conditioner. This simplifies the work, shortens the installation time, and allows for reliable and stable installation.

As shown in FIG. 6, the conventional mounting device is such that an air conditioner 1 that does not protrude outside the room is mounted on an installation frame 3 whose upper and lower ends are fixed to a window frame 2, and at the rear of both sides of the air conditioner 1. It had a structure in which it was secured by screwing with a plurality of screws 6 via a fixed mounting flange 4.

In such a structure, all of the protrusion of the air conditioner is on the indoor side, so the center of gravity is also on the indoor side, so when installing the air conditioner, always support the air conditioner with your body when tightening the screws. , which is extremely difficult to work with and dangerous, and also requires a lot of screws, making installation time-consuming. Furthermore, during the off-season, these air conditioners are often removed because their protrusion into the room becomes a nuisance, but this is also dangerous and time-consuming.

An embodiment of the present invention will be described below with reference to FIGS. 1 to 4 of the accompanying drawings. In the figure, reference numeral 1 denotes a window-mounted air conditioner that protrudes outward from the room, and has a built-in refrigeration cycle consisting of a compressor, condenser, evaporator, etc., and a fan, etc. (not shown). The condenser 6 and the blow-off lower are provided on the same surface at the back of the air conditioner 1, so that heat is exchanged with outdoor air only at the outdoor back. 2 is a window frame made of aluminum sash, etc.
Reference numeral 3 denotes an installation frame whose upper and lower ends are fixed to the window frame 2. The installation frame 3 consists of left and right symmetrical vertical frames 8, 8 and an upper frame 9. A rectangular frame main body 11 consisting of a lower frame 10, and an inverted U-shaped sliding frame 12 whose both ends are inserted into the vertical frame 8 and can be slid freely according to the height of the window frame 2. Sliding frame 12 with and
It is composed of a resin panel 13 that closes the inside of the housing.

Inwardly recessed step portions 14 are formed at the rear portions of both sides of the air conditioner 1, and a rearward-facing contact surface 15 of the step portion 14 is provided with insulation between the air conditioner 1 and the installation frame 3. A plurality of locking holes 17 into which insulating bushings 16 made of synthetic resin are inserted are provided for measurement. Further, a top step 18 recessed inward is formed at the rear of the top of the air conditioner 14, and an L-shaped top flange 19 made of synthetic resin is fixed to the top step 18. A through hole 21 is provided in the vertical portion 2o of the top flange 19, into which a screw 22 is inserted.

On the other hand, as shown in FIG. 3, the vertical frame 8 of the installation frame 3 is a long piece with a substantially U-shaped cross section that opens inward, and has one U-shaped end bent toward the front at several places. L-shaped hook part 23
This hook portion 23 is connected to the locking hole 17.
The air conditioner 1 is attached to the installation frame 3 by locking the air conditioner 1 to the installation frame 3. Still on the inside of the vertical frame 8, an insulating plate 26 having a substantially rectangular cross-sectional shape and having a soft seal 24 at one end and a notch matching the hook portion 23 at the other end is adhesively fixed. Rainwater is prevented from entering between the air conditioner 1 and the installation frame 3, and electrical insulation between the air conditioner 1 and the installation frame 3 is ensured.

The lower frame 10 of the installation frame 3 is shaped like a saucer with continuous rises 26 on three sides, and the - side is bent downward to face the window frame 2. It is connected and fixed to the lower end of the frame 8. A sealing material 2 is still adhered to the upper surface of the lower frame 10 in the vicinity of the riser 24 to prevent rainwater from entering through the space 75 between the air conditioner 1 and the lower frame 1o.
- Also, the upper frame 9 of the installation frame 3 is connected to the vertical frame 8.
One end of the U-shape has a cross-sectional shape bent further upward to form a slotted slot insertion groove 28, and a through hole of the top flange 19 is formed in the lower surface 29 of the slotted groove 28. A screw seat 30 matching with 21 is provided.

In addition, an upper sealing material 31 such as a soft synthetic resin is adhered to the lower surface of the upper frame 9 on the opposite side of the flannel insertion groove 28 to prevent rainwater from entering between the air conditioner 1 and the upper frame 9. ing.

The present invention is constructed as described above, and in order to attach the air conditioner 1 to the installation frame 3 whose upper and lower ends are fixed to the window frame 2 and into which the panels 13 are inserted, first the air conditioner 1
The air conditioner 1 is attached to the installation frame 3 by locking the locking hole 17 provided in the side step 14 of the installation frame 3 with the hook part 23 of the vertical frame 8 of the installation frame 3.
Then, screws 22 are inserted into the upper frame 9 of the installation frame 3 through the through holes 21 provided in the top flange 19 of the air conditioner 1.
Just screw it into the screw seat 2B provided in the. To remove it, reversely remove the screws 22 and then remove the side step 14 of the air conditioner 1.
17 and the hook portion 23 of the installation frame 3 may be released.

In this way, the air conditioner 1 can be installed by simply locking the locking hole 17 of the air conditioner 1 with the hook part 23 of the installation frame 3, and then screwing in the screw 22. There is no need to tighten screws while supporting the air conditioner 1 with the body, and there is no risk of it falling. This is exactly the same when the air conditioner 1 is removed. Further, since there is a completely electrically insulated structure between the air conditioner 1 and the installation frame 3, leakage of electricity from the air conditioner 1 will not cause damage to the building. A sealing material 27 is provided inside the installation frame 3.
Seal 24. Since the upper sealing material 31 is provided, it is possible to prevent the infiltration of rainwater, and the external dimensions of the installation frame 3 in the width direction are almost the same as the external dimensions of the air conditioner 1 in the width direction, resulting in a smart aesthetic appearance. It can be used as a good installation frame.
